IMEG is growing, and we’d love to have you join our team! We are currently seeking a Electrical Engineering Graduate - Designer 1 in our Pensacola, FL office. As a Electrical Engineering Graduate - Designer 1 you will be responsible for performing calculations, system design, equipment selections, reports, progress submittals and BIM instructions for their project to assure project completeness and accuracy within the allocated period and monetary budget.

Some key duties and responsibilities include:

  • Design portions of a project related to electrical systems according to code and IMEG standards
  • Research resources for commercially available equipment
  • Assist with good client relations, project design notebook, and provide documentation for permanent record files
  • Assist with coordinating design and schedule with other disciplines such as architectural, structural, mechanical, technology, clerical, and equipment suppliers
  • Assist with documenting design decisions, meetings, and instructions from client promptly while monitoring project design progress
  • Assist with review of all project documents for accuracy and completeness prior to requesting a final check
  • Assist with preparation and issuance of addendum information
  • Review design methods, procedures, changes in scope, and client correspondence with the Lead Engineer
  • Conduct periodic job site observations and all other services as required by the contract services agreement
  • Other duties assigned


Key skills and abilities needed for the position are:

  • Knowledge of design techniques, tools, and principles involved in production of precision technical plans and drawings
  • Knowledge and prediction of physical principles, laws, and their interrelationships, and applications to understanding fluid, material, and atmospheric dynamics
  • Skill in the use of Microsoft Office programs, CAD software and BIM
  • Ability to clearly communicate in both oral and written communication to individuals or groups
  • Routine local travel with occasional overnight stays


Education and experience requirements are:

  • Bachelor's Degree (Science) or equivalent
  • Electrical building systems design and/or knowledge of construction techniques a plus
